Expert Review
PetSmart offers a part-time Retail Sales Associate position, primarily engaging with pet parents and their pets. Pay ranges from $13 to $19 per hour, making it competitive for entry-level retail jobs. The benefits, including 401k matching and tuition assistance, are notable for part-time roles.
